I'm soon going to put a new steering rack gaiter on my Morris as one of mine has fell to bits & it looks very dry inside.
Once I've replaced it how much oil should I put in the rack? I know normally you only put a few strokes of the grease gun (filled with ep90), but with the damaged gaiter will it have lost all of its contents?

Also, I've heard people say it's ok to use moly grease in the rack where others say stick to ep90, which is best?
I do have some semi fluid grease as it's specified for the gearbox in my AJS, would this be any good as it's thicker than ep90 but runnier than grease or is it best to stick to original recommendations?

I use the moly grease - it doesn't run away and hide in the bellows.... The old guard will be along to insist on EP90....because it says so in the 50 year old Manual..... :roll: :lol: Your fluid grease sound ideal!

Semi fluid grease sounds like a good compromise or put a few shots of EP90 to make the grease more mobile.
